Table 1 Baseline clinicopathological features of 61 patients with idiopathic membranous nephropathy.
Characteristics | Homogeneous (n=44) | Heterogeneous (n=17) | P |
---|---|---|---|
Age (years) | 52.20±10.45 | 51.59±14.95 | 0.856 |
Male/Female | 30/14 | 8/9 | 0.127 |
Proteinuria (g/24 h) | 4.56±0.82 | 5.06±0.87 | 0.042 |
Alb (g/L) | 24.71±3.57 | 22.01±4.17 | 0.014 |
SCr (μmol/L) | 81.82±25.87 | 85.88±30.77 | 0.604 |
Systolic pressure (mmHg) | 137.61±18.37 | 147.94±12.29 | 0.037 |
Diastolic pressure (mmHg) | 83.98±14.41 | 90.12±11.23 | 0.120 |
Cholesterol (mmol/L) | 8.38±2.54 | 9.67±2.61 | 0.083 |
ACEI/ARB used (n) | 26 | 10 | 0.985 |
Basement membrane thickness(nm) | 986.36±247.40 | 1198.8±283.33 | 0.005 |
Renal biopsy (I/II/III/IV) (n) | 2/36/6/0 | 2/4/11/0 | 0.000 |
Alb – albumin; Scr – serum creatinine. |
